### AI review details

- **Review stage:** source\_first\_review

- **Mechanism:** Install-time overwrite-and-symlink of global AI-agent skills.

- **Attack narrative:** On npm postinstall, the package enumerates its bundled SKILLS and installs them into global Claude and Codex skill roots. Its forceSymlink helper recursively removes any existing target before creating a symlink to package-controlled instructions. This is unconsented install-time mutation of broad, foreign AI-agent control surfaces.

- **Rationale:** Source inspection confirms the critical behavior directly: postinstall overwrites global Claude/Codex skill entries rather than requiring an explicit setup command. This meets the firewall block boundary even without a remote payload or credential exfiltration chain.

- **Files touched:** ~/.claude/skills/ufoo, ~/.claude/skills/ufoo-bus, ~/.claude/skills/ufoo-context, ~/.claude/skills/ufoo-online, ${CODEX\_HOME:-~/.codex}/skills/ufoo, ${CODEX\_HOME:-~/.codex}/skills/ufoo-bus, ${CODEX\_HOME:-~/.codex}/skills/ufoo-context, ${CODEX\_HOME:-~/.codex}/skills/ufoo-online

### 13. Critical: Ai Agent Control Hijack
- **Category:** Source
- **Confidence:** 90.0%
- **Path:** scripts/postinstall.js
- **Public source:** [View source](<https://unpkg.com/u-foo@3.0.24/scripts/postinstall.js>)

Source creates an unconsented AI-agent control surface through install-time mutation or a default unauthenticated remote skill channel.
